The St. Lawrence River water levels have decreased considerably, with latest forecasts by the Canadian Coast Guard predicting further reductions.

We therefore would like to inform you that with effect from January 1, 2019, Hapag-Lloyd will implement a Low Water Surcharge for all cargo moving to/via the port of Montreal as follows:

St. Lawrence Cont. Service – Route 1 (AT1) and 2 (AT2) - westbound

  • USD 100 per 20' Container
  • USD 150 per 40' Container

Mediterranean Canada Service (MCA) - westbound

  • USD 75 per 20' Container
  • USD 100 per 40' Container

We reserve the right to increase these levels on short notice, should water levels decline beyond current forecast levels.
